Secfi
Back End Developer
SecfiNetherlands17 hours ago
Full-timeRemote FriendlyEngineering, Information Technology

About Secfi

Secfi is trusted by thousands of tech professionals for financial planning and financing. We’re the first to provide a proprietary suite of equity planning tools, 1:1 guidance with licensed equity strategists, and a set of financing products that enable employees to own a stake in the company they helped build. Currently, we have over 52,000 users on our platform owning over $90bn worth of equity, and have worked with employees from more than 90% of all U.S. unicorns.


Role overview

We’re looking for a Back-End Engineer to join our team in Amsterdam. This is a mid-to-senior level position on our engineering team, where you’ll work closely with product and design to build and evolve the core of Secfi’s platform.


You’ll have the opportunity to lead initiatives and shape technical decisions from day one. This role is ideal for someone who enjoys solving complex problems, wants agency in how things get built, and is excited about building systems that help people make better financial decisions.


What you’ll do

  • Build APIs and services to power our equity planning platform and internal tools.
  • Collaborate with product, design, and front-end engineers to define features, and bring new experiences to life.
  • Design, develop, and maintain systems that are secure, scalable, and efficient.
  • Support product in data analysis and experimentation to inform decisions.
  • Contribute to architectural decisions and help improve system performance and reliability.
  • Help maintain and evolve our infrastructure on AWS and Kubernetes.


You will work on projects like:

  • Integrate AI into our planning tools
  • Build a notification center for users to keep track of their opportunities
  • Financial planning and tax calculation APIs


Our stack:

  • Backend: Python 3.11, FastAPI, SQLAlchemy, Pydantic, Celery, Django, Node
  • Tooling & Quality: uv, ruff, mypy, pytest
  • Data Stores: PostgreSQL, Redis
  • Infrastructure: Kubernetes, AWS, Terraform, CircleCI


What we’re looking for

  • 3–6+ years of back-end development experience.
  • Strong command of Python and designing APIs (RESTful, bonus points for GraphQL).
  • Experience with relational databases, preferably PostgreSQL.
  • Familiarity with cloud platforms (ideally AWS) and container orchestration (Kubernetes).
  • Ability to take ownership of features and collaborate across disciplines.
  • An eye for simplicity, security, maintainability and performance.
  • Authorized to work in the EU.


Why you’ll love working here

  • A friendly and collaborative environment where engineers lead projects and have real agency.
  • A culture that values simplicity, autonomy, and people feeling safe and recognized.
  • A cool office on the IJ waterfront in Amsterdam (near Centraal), with lunch provided on office days.
  • Hybrid setup: we work from the office on Tuesdays, Thursdays, and every second Monday.
  • Competitive compensation, equity ownership, and the chance to build something meaningful.


What the hiring process looks like

  • Introductory interview — 30 min (video call)
  • Technical interview — 90 min (in person or video call): Comprised of a programming skills assessment (code review & fix) and an architecture jam (design a back-end feature)
  • Value-fit interview — 60 min
  • Meet the CEO — 30 min
  • Reference checks (async)

Key Skills

Ranked by relevance